Abstract

Two years ago Dr. Tewes, professor of law, who resides in Graz, and I, according to regular procedure, proposed a motion as members of the Association; and I wish to make a protest because it has been denied by our committee, namely because it was classified as ‘unsuitable for deliberation’ by the Association of Jurists and has been excluded from the agenda. I shall establish my protest materially and formally.
